Output 5abe341160526c355295e0c821fa5692a886d380b42efaccf64188d3eb2d4f6d:61

value
182747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0669861174ca983509f2ffb86a5ec031b1417a OP_EQUAL
address
3P2RixcbqgG8uZiod6fYAbBQiKiG9Rc5qW
transaction
5abe341160526c355295e0c821fa5692a886d380b42efaccf64188d3eb2d4f6d
spent
true